Angelo State University Location: San Angelo Acceptance Rate: 77% Undergrad Enrollment: 9,046 Angelo State University was founded in 1928 under the name "San Angelo College." Today, it is part of the Texas Tech University System, and has the second largest campus of any university affiliated with Texas Tech. Potential recruits looking to land a roster spot at one of the nations division 3 basketball teams are in luck. There are currently more than 400 Division 3 basketball schools in the nationthese 424 D3 basketball colleges make up the largest division level not only in the NCAA, but also among all four-year colleges.
